
James' Perfect Pitching Helps JetHawks to 12-6 Exhibition Win
Published on March 31, 2008 under California League (CalL1)
Lancaster JetHawks News Release
(LANCASTER, CA) - The Lancaster JetHawks continue to show signs of being ready for the start of the regular season. Jimmy James hurled a perfect three innings and the JetHawks pounded out 14 hits as they defeated the Master's College 12-6 in a seven inning exhibition game Monday night at Clear Channel Stadium.
James dominated the collegiate athletes in his first start at Clear Channel Stadium. Expertly controlling his fastball, James struck out five Mustangs players as he retired all nine batters he faced. Only one hitter got the ball out the infield in the three innings. Brian Steinocher and Richie Lentz struggled in relief, but returner T.J. Large, who saved nine games for the JetHawks a season ago, closed down the Mustangs over the final innings to seal the win.
There was plenty of offense for the JetHawks as they scored in all but one inning. Zak Farkes had three hits and three runs driven in for Lancaster, including a two-run homer that exited Clear Channel Stadium and bounced on Ave. I. Christian Lara added three singles, giving him five hits in the two exhibition games thus far. Mickey Hall added a two-run home run in the win.
